" An ideal opportunity to purchase this large Victorian home which has been maintained to a high standard retaining many original features and located within walking distance of Thirsk town centre .Offering excellent family accommodation to include Entry Vestibule, Reception Hall, Lounge, Dining Room, Breakfast room, Kitchen, Utility, Cloakroom, Cellar, 4 Bedrooms, house Bathroom, Attic Room, Pleasant Courtyard Garden to the rear with off road parking for 2 cars. ENTRY with the original hardwood entry door into the home's Vestibule which retains the original stained glass door leading into the Reception Hall. RECEPTION HALL A large and welcoming Reception Hall with the original cornice ceiling, dado rail, deep 12 skirting boards, and original staircase to the first floor accommodation. There is access to the home's Lounge, Dining Room and Breakfast Room with a central heating radiator.
LOUNGE With its original cornice and ceiling rose the room also a large Bay window with double sash windows to the front of the home, living flame gas fire set in a tiled surround, television and telephone points. There is a window seat suitable for storage and a central heating radiator, DINING ROOM The dining room still retains the original cornice, coved ceilings, ceiling rose and skirting boards. There are also patio doors opening to the court yard area and there is an open fire with a tiled inset and hearth, In addition, there is a central heating radiator. BREAKFAST ROOM From the reception hall, the breakfast room has a large sash window to the side aspect, open fire, alcove storage cupboards, access to the kitchen and cellar, corniced ceilings and a central heating radiator. KITCHEN A fitted kitchen comprising of base and wall unite with roll top work surfaces. There is also a sink with mixer tap, tiled splash backs, fitted oven and grill, hob with extractor hood and wood laminate flooring. There are also three sash windows to the side over looking the large court yard and a door leading to the utility room. UTILITY / PANTRY Accessed from the kitchen, this small room offers both excellent additional storage for dry goods for the kitchen but also plumbing for a washing machine. BOOT ROOM From the kitchen, this room may offer additional storage and has doors leading to the kitchen and the shower room. There is a solid timber door to the courtyard and a window. There is also a further storage cupboard and wood laminate flooring SHOWER / CLOAK ROOM With a shower cubicle, w.c., pedestal sink, and a sash window to the rear aspect. CELLAR Accessed from the Breakfast room, this useful area is currently utilised as an office. The current vendors have had the room tanked out and have also installed a central heating radiator. There is also a Upvc window to the rear aspect. LANDING The landing still retains the original corniced ceilings and sash window to the side aspect. There is access to the four bedrooms and bathroom with a useful under stair storage cupboard. There is also a door leading to the second floor. MASTER BEDROOM 3.99m(13'1'') x 3.61m(11'10'') An extremely spacious Master Bedroom with high ceilings retaining the cornice and picture rail. There is a sash double glazed window to the rear aspect and a central heating radiator. BEDROOM TWO A large double bedroom with ceiling cornice, picture rail and Upvc windows to the side and rear aspect and a double central heating radiator. BEDROOM THREE Positioned to the front of the home, this bedroom has a sash window, corniced ceilings and a central heating radiator. BEDROOM FOUR This single bedroom has a sash window to the front aspect, corniced ceilings and a central heating radiator. BATHROOM Fitted with a suite comprising panelled bath, pedestal sink and w.c and a separate shower cubicle. There is also a tiled surround, central heating radiator and two sash windows to the side aspect. ATTIC ROOM A very useful room currently utilised as a further work space.. This room does benefit from two Velux roof lights to the rear of the home and a central heating radiator. FRONT GARDEN To the front of the home, the garden area is easily maintained with brick wall, wrought iron railings and gate. There are shrub and herbaceous borders. COURTYARD GARDEN Accessed from the kitchen and dining room, the court yard is private and has been flagged through out. There are well established trees and shrubs. Within the court yard, there is an outbuilding which offers further storage. A timber gate leads to the gardens which are accessed over the communal road for the terraced homes. GARDEN The garden is laid to lawn with a small area designated for a vegetable patch. There are also a range of established beds and flowering borders. PARKING There is hard standing for two vehicles and , subject to planning, may be suitable for a garage. SERVICES CENTRAL HEATING : GAS
